• 6–12 ft of ½-in CSST or black iron pipe
• Appliance flex connector rated 30,000 BTU+
• Shut-off valve, sediment trap, and pipe dope
• 4-in galvanized vent pipe, elbows, and exterior hood
• Foil tape (no screws) for duct joints
• CO detector if not already present in the laundry space
• Position the shut-off within 6 ft of the dryer for quick emergency access
• Use a bubble solution, not an open flame, during leak checks to avoid fire risk
• Keep the vent run as straight as possible; every 90-degree elbow equals 5 extra feet of length
• Elevate the vent termination at least 12 inches above finished grade to prevent snow blockage
• Photograph rough-in piping before drywall for future remodeling reference
